"WWE Founder Vince McMahon Resigns Amid Sexual Misconduct Allegations"
TL;DR Summary
Wrestling icon Vince McMahon resigned from WWE's parent company after a former employee filed a federal lawsuit accusing him and another former executive of serious sexual misconduct, including offering her to a star wrestler for sex. McMahon denied the allegations and stepped down as executive chairman of the board of directors at TKO Group Holdings, stating that he intends to vigorously defend himself. The lawsuit also names WWE and an ex-pro wrestler as defendants, alleging that McMahon forced the plaintiff into a sexual relationship in exchange for a job and passed around pornographic material of her.
